TASK 11.1, M1 Computer Systems and their environmentsComputer systems are the basic requirement in every environment be it at personal levelor for offices and professional networks. Computers are the medium through which people canlearn, develop and stay updated with the advancements that are made in all parts of the worldthrough internet (BellMudge and McNamara, 2014). Professional networks include outsourcingcompanies, supermarkets, malls, huge multinationals to SMEs. All the operations can be handledeasily through these systems and without any negligence that is often caused by human errors.The different environments for computer systems are mentioned below:1.Education: Imparting education through digital platforms always help in interactivelearning and best performance of the students. Normally an array of minicomputers isused in these systems with automated systems and distance learning platforms(BellMudge and McNamara, 2014).2.Business: All kinds of businesses require computer systems. Databases and informationtechnology is the base for the development and success of the company. The peripheralsthat are required for this kind of environment are internet, intranet, data sharing,management of employee database, etc. Supermarkets are also kind of businesses thatrequire computer systems (Åström and Wittenmark, 2013). 3.Government: Government has the huge task of maintaining information regarding theactivities of all its citizens and working departments. This is a massive task if compared

to be done manually but computer systems ease the work. Automation has been the keyto this function.4.Military: The armed forces have the duty of protecting the country from all sorts ofdangers is it internally or externally. Hence, they have to use such computer systems thatease their work and provide accurate results in time of emergency. Supercomputers andmainframe computers used by the military.5.Real time: The environments that are controlled and managed by the activities of acomputer system are the real time ones. For example, all sorts of computer systems thatare used for controlling traffic on roads, airbase, etc. are the real time computing systems.The supermarkets can use business environment computing system and thee real time systemfor performing and controlling all the activities inside and outside the physical location (Ofalsa,2014).
